After an Echo device and a gadget establish a connection over Bluetooth Low Energy (BLE) or Classic Bluetooth, they exchange data packets of one of two types, depending on the transport:
Although the packet format does not, in a general sense, specifically relate to the Bluetooth type, in the case of gadgets they correspond as described in this documentation.
